Bikernick, sorry don't know about RK, but Scrounger I have an 09 Ultra. I asked at dealership how they hooked up zumos. Told me they went into the fairing and wired to the headlight so that power would be on when ignition is on. I wanted to wire to the "aux" rocker so that I could turn it off if not using it. The guys on this forum walked me thru it last year. There is a four pin connector under seat wired to battery. It is buried a bit down the side of the battery. I ran my zumo power cord thru the side of the fairing and under the chrome trim across top of gas tank then under seat to battery. Only had to loosen the chrome trim, it was very easy. I used a $5 volt meter and checked each pin, found one pin hot off ignition (with ignition turned on), one hot off of "aux" rocker (with rocker turned on), a ground and fourth pin is for aux brake lights if you turn yellow blinkers into brake lights. Took about 5 mins to wire my zumo into the "aux" pin and ground. Couldn't have done it without all the advice on this site. Instead of cutting into the connector, I bought the following part number, 70264-94A, it is $18. It is called a "Switched Circuit Adapter Harness". It plugs into the pigtail under the seat and splits into two connectors, allowing two accessories to be connected to the switched accessory rocker circuit. I cut one to tie in my zumo, which left the other side intact just as if i still had the original plug available. Hope it helps, kinda hard to explain. Can take a pic if you need it.
